SUN DEVIL DATA: Local product who is a skilled big man and excellent student-athlete. The Arizona Republic All-Metro (Phoenix) Player of the Year in 2008-09 and a member of the five-man All-Arizona team. Had career game of 47 points (school record), 18 rebounds and four three-pointers against Phoenix Horizon in January of 2008. Coached by Charlie Wilde in high school. Volunteer hours for the community totaled nearly 300. Set school records for charges taken in season (21) and career (61).

SCHOOL RECORDS: Easiest way to detail is to just list them, as Rohde set school season records for free throws made (177), free throws attempted (241), rebounds (306), points (855), blocks (75), two-point field goals made (300) and attempted (433) and offensive boards (123). For career marks, he set them for free throws made (564), free throws attempted (667), rebounds (1,034), points (2,226), blocks (216), and field goal percentage (.630).

PINNACLE HIGH SCHOOL: Averaged 29.5 points (school record), 12.0 rebounds and shot 63 percent from field in senior season...2008 Gatorade Arizona Player of the Year and McDonald's All-America nominee...2008 Pima Region Player of the Year...earned Arizona Republic first-team all-state for three straight years...played in Nike top-100 camp in St. Louis in 2005...earned MVP of Desert Shootout Tournament in 2005 and 2006...played at Double Pump West Coast and Pangos All-American Camp in 2007.

ETC.: Full name is Taylor Hunter Rohde...born in Lebedon, N.H., on May 2, 1990...father is Lamont Rohde and Mother is Karen Rohde...has two younger sisters Alexandra and Jordyn.
